Brief Summary
The objective of this study is to conduct a open-label pilot study evaluating the feasibility, tolerability and preliminary efficacy of a 12-week course of synbiotic in improving anxiety symptoms in c...

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- ASD children of Chinese ethnicity aged \<12 with diagnosis made by child psychiatrists based on Diagnostic and Statistical Manual, Fifth Edition (DSM-5) diagnostic criteria.
- Elevated anxiety level, as measured by Anxiety Scale for Children-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ASC-ASD)
- Presence of sensory hyperresponsiveness, as measured by Sensory Experience Questionnaire (SEQ)
Exclusion
- Co-occurring mental retardation, neurological, psychosis, depression or other severe mental illness.
- History of non-functional gastrointestinal disorders such as inflammatory bowel disease and Hirschsprung's disease.
- Presence of other significant physical illness, including but not limited to: current active malignancy, immunosuppression, organ failure and epilepsy
- Exposure to antibiotics within 1 months of the study or history of using probiotics.
- On special diet such as being a vegetarian
